Overview Lariten 20mg Tablet

Diabetac 20mg tablets are indicated for the management of type 2 diabetes. Optimal blood glucose control is achieved through concurrent dietary modifications, regular physical activity, and this medication. This approach helps mitigate serious diabetic complications, such as visual impairment and renal dysfunction. Diabetac 20mg is typically prescribed when lifestyle adjustments and alternative treatments fail to adequately manage blood sugar. Your physician might recommend it as monotherapy or in conjunction with other antidiabetic agents. It may be administered with or without food, with dosage determined by your individual health status and glycemic levels. Adhere strictly to your doctor's prescribed regimen. Consistent daily dosing at the same time maximizes therapeutic efficacy. Discontinue use only under medical supervision. This medication aids in blood glucose regulation and long-term complication prevention. Continued adherence to your prescribed diet and exercise plan is crucial. Lifestyle choices significantly influence diabetes management. Commonly reported adverse effects include hypoglycemia, bowel irregularity, vertigo, cephalalgia, and diarrhea. Recognizing hypoglycemic symptoms (e.g., lightheadedness, diaphoresis, faintness, xerostomia) and appropriate countermeasures (e.g., glucose tablets) is essential. Consult your physician concerning persistent or concerning side effects. Prior to initiating treatment, inform your doctor of any pre-existing renal, cardiovascular, or pancreatic conditions. Pregnant or lactating individuals should seek medical counsel before use. Potential drug interactions may occur; therefore, disclose all concurrent medications to your physician. Moderate alcohol consumption is advised due to the heightened risk of hypoglycemia. Regular monitoring of renal function and blood glucose levels may be necessary to assess treatment effectiveness.

How Lariten 20mg Tablet works:

Diabetac 20mg tablets help manage blood sugar. They stimulate insulin production in the pancreas while suppressing counter-regulatory hormones. This leads to lower blood glucose, both before and after meals.

FAQs on Lariten 20mg Tablet

Lariten 20mg Tablets aren't associated with weight gain. Maintaining a healthy weight is crucial for diabetes management. If you gain weight while using Lariten 20mg Tablets, consult your doctor.
Lariten 20mg tablets are generally safe for kidneys with normal function. However, always disclose any current or past kidney issues to your doctor, as dose adjustment may be necessary.
Maintaining a healthy diet and regular exercise is crucial alongside Lariten 20mg Tablet treatment. Effective blood sugar control requires both medication and a healthy lifestyle, including balanced nutrition and physical activity. Consult a dietitian to create a personalized diet plan. A balanced diet, combined with at least thirty minutes of daily exercise like brisk walking, forms a vital part of managing type 2 diabetes.
Low blood sugar (hypoglycemia) is a possible side effect of Lariten 20mg Tablet, especially when combined with other diabetes medications or insulin, or if you skip meals, over-exercise, or take too much Lariten. Report any sudden drops in blood sugar to your doctor, who may adjust your dosage. Regular blood sugar monitoring and following your doctor's instructions are crucial.
Lariten 20mg tablets control, but don't cure, diabetes. Continue taking them as your doctor directs; this may be lifelong. Consistent blood sugar control is crucial to avoid serious complications, so don't discontinue use without consulting your doctor.
Taking more than your prescribed dose of Lariten 20mg Tablets can cause dangerously low blood sugar (hypoglycemia). This can range from mild symptoms like anxiety, sweating, weakness, tremors, and rapid heartbeat, to severe episodes causing seizures or unconsciousness. Monitor your blood sugar closely for 24 hours. Treat mild hypoglycemia with sugary foods like candy or fruit juice. However, severe hypoglycemia is a medical emergency requiring immediate attention. Consult your doctor for guidance on further treatment.
Take a missed dose as soon as you remember, unless it's almost time for your next dose. In that case, skip the missed dose and continue with your regular schedule. Never take two Lariten 20mg Tablets at once.
Lariten 20mg Tablets are safe when taken as prescribed, but rare, serious side effects are possible. Pancreatitis, a potentially fatal inflammation of the pancreas, may occur; seek immediate medical attention if you experience severe or persistent abdominal pain. Heart failure, where the heart's pumping ability is impaired, is another potential risk. Disclose any history of heart or kidney problems to your doctor before starting Lariten 20mg Tablets.
Yes, long-term use of Lariten 20mg Tablet is safe, even for months, years, or a lifetime. Prolonged use hasn't shown harmful effects. Continue taking it as directed by your doctor. However, remember this medication manages, but doesn't cure, diabetes.
